Franklin Parish is a perfect 3-0 against Peabody since November of 2022 and they'll have a chance to extend that dominance on Friday. The Patriots will host the Warhorses at 7:00 p.m. Keep an eye on the score for this one: the two teams posted some lofty point totals in their previous games.
As a matter of fact, Franklin Parish put up the most points they have all season on Friday. They blew past West Ouachita, posting a 55-28 win. The Patriots might be getting used to big wins seeing as the team has won four contests by 27 points or more this season.

It was another big night for Treylon Martin, who rushed for 153 yards and a pair of scores on only nine carries. He is becoming a predictor of Franklin Parish's success: when he posts at least 80 rushing yards the team is undefeated (and 1-2 when he doesn't). Another back making a difference was DJ Neal, who rushed for 91 yards and one TD on only five carries.
They were just one part of a punishing run game: Franklin Parish was unstoppable on the ground and finished the game with 314 rushing yards. That's the most rushing yards they've posted since back in November of 2024.
Special teams also deserves some recognition, posting 19 points in total. The biggest highlight from special teams (and perhaps the team as a whole) came courtesy of Avery Johnson, who ran a kickoff back for a touchdown. Another bright spot was a punt return touchdown from Kaaron Jones.
Meanwhile, there's no place like home for Peabody, who bounced back after a loss on the road last Friday. They walked away with a 54-41 victory over Grant on Friday. The win was a breath of fresh air for the Warhorses as it put an end to their three-game losing streak.
Peabody's victory bumped their record up to 2-3. As for Franklin Parish, their win bumped their record up to 4-2.
Everything came up roses for Franklin Parish against Peabody in their previous matchup back in October of 2024, as the team secured a 48-0 victory. Do the Patriots have another victory up their sleeve, or will the Warhorses turn the tables on them? We'll have the answer soon enough.
